Carrington is pricing at a median of $410,000, with price per square foot at $261.69 — a number that tells you condition and layout are doing most of the work here, since no shared amenities are showing up in current MLS data to add a premium. With year-over-year pricing down 4.7%, this is not a market where sellers can lean on momentum; it is one where the listing itself has to make the case.
A median of 41 days on market and a heat score of 39 point to a buyer-favorable pace rather than a competitive scramble. That gives buyers room to negotiate and time to actually evaluate a property, while sellers need to price to current comps rather than last year's numbers.

The 60-Second Overview
Carrington market snapshot (as of July 29, 2026): the median sale price is about $410K ($262 per sq ft over the trailing 12 months of closed sales), and a median 41 days on market for closed sales. The trailing-12-month median is down 5% from the prior 12 months, computed from record-level fgc closed sales (13 closings in the current window).
Carrington sits in Naples within Collier County, and with only 13 closings in the most recent window, pricing here reflects a smaller, thinner data set rather than a broad, deep market — meaning each closing carries more weight in what the numbers say.

Where the value actually sits
With no community amenities identified from current listings, Carrington's value proposition is the home and the lot, not a clubhouse or a gate. That puts more pressure on buyers to evaluate square footage, updates, and layout on their own merits rather than assuming a shared feature justifies the price per square foot.
The combination of a negative year-over-year trend and a 41-day median suggests this is a market working through a repricing period. Thirteen closings is a small enough sample that a single well-priced or poorly-priced listing can move the median noticeably, so buyers and sellers should look at recent, comparable closings rather than the headline number alone.
